PTFE Coated Fibreglas Fabric ka jogo kɛrɛnkɛrɛnnenw


Dielektriki baarakɛcogo danfaralen

PTFE fini min dilannen don ni fibreglasi ye, o bɛ waso ni dielektriki kɛcogo kabakomaw ye, o b’a danfara bɔ PCB fɛn kɔrɔw la. A ka dielektriki sabatili dɔgɔyalen, a ka c’a la, a bɛ daminɛ 2,1 na ka se 2,65 ma, o bɛ taamasiyɛnw tigɛli ni ɲɔgɔn cɛtigɛcogo dɔgɔya sɛrɛkiliw la minnu ka ca. O jogo in nafa ka bon kosɛbɛ taamasiyɛn dafalen sabatili la baarakɛminɛnw na, pikosekɔndi kelen-kelen bɛɛ bɛ jate yɔrɔ minnu na. O fɛn in ka tiɲɛni hakɛ dɔgɔyali bɛ a ka baara kɛcogo ɲɛ ka t’a fɛ ni taamasiyɛn bɔnɛni dɔgɔyali ye, o bɛ kɛ sababu ye ka fanga cicogo ɲuman sɔrɔ ani ka sɛrɛkili bɛɛ lajɛlen baarakɛcogo ɲɛ.


Sumaya sabatili ani a hakɛw ɲɔgɔndan

o fɛn dɔ PTFE fini min dilannen don ni fibreglasi ye, ye a ka funteni sabatili danma ye. O fɛn in b’a ka kuran ni masin cogoyaw mara funteni hakɛ caman na, k’a ta kiriyɔzɛni cogoyaw la ka se funteni ma min bɛ tɛmɛ 250°C kan. O sabatili in bɛ baarakɛcogo basigilen sabati sigida gɛlɛnw na, o b’a to a ka ɲi kosɛbɛ sanfɛla ni sɔrɔdasiw ka baarakɛcogo la. Ka fara o kan, fini in ka coefficient d’expansion thermal (CTE) dɔgɔyali bɛ kɛ sababu ye ka dimensions sabatili ɲuman kɛ, ka warpage dɔgɔya ani ka circuit geometries tigitigiw mara hali ni thermal stress.


Kimikisɛw kɛlɛli ani jibɔbaliya

PTFE dacogo bɛ kemikaliya setigiya ɲuman di fibreglasi fini ma, k’a tanga fura suguya caman ma, asidiw ani fɛn wɛrɛw ma minnu bɛ a tiɲɛ. O kɛlɛli nafa ka bon kɛrɛnkɛrɛnnenya la izini sigida gɛlɛnw na walima baarakɛcogo minnu bɛ sɔrɔ kemikɛli cogoya gɛlɛnw na. Ka fara o kan, PTFE ka jibɔbaliya b’a to fini tɛ se ka don ji la kosɛbɛ, o bɛ PCB ka kuran dafalen lakana ani ka ko dɔw bali i n’a fɔ delamination walima signal tiɲɛni ka da nɛnɛ kan.


Baarakɛcogo ni nafa minnu bɛ sɔrɔ PCB dilancogo la min bɛ kɛ ni fɛn caman ye


5G ani Telefɔniko ɲɛtaa

5G rezow daminɛni ye ɲininiw bila PCB fɛnw kan minnu ɲɔgɔn ma deli ka kɛ fɔlɔ, o kɛra sababu ye ka substratw wajibiya minnu bɛ se ka milimɛtɛrɛ-wave frequences (milimɛtɛrɛ-wave frequences) ɲɛnabɔ ni bɔnɛ fitinin ye. PTFE fini min dilannen don ni fibreglasi ye, o wulila ka se nin gɛlɛya in ma, a bɛ dielektriki basigilen dɔgɔman di ani bɔnɛ dɔgɔman tangɛnt min ka kan ka kɛ walasa ka taamasiyɛnw jɛnsɛnni ɲuman kɛ ni fɔkanw ye minnu ka ca ni 24 GHz ye. A baara kɛli 5G basigiyɔrɔw la, seli misɛnninw na, ani kiliyanw ka yɔrɔ minɛnw (CPE) la, o kɛra sababu ye ka kunnafonidilanw hakɛ caman sɔrɔ ani ka latɛmɛni dɔgɔya, layidu tara minnu bɛ sɔrɔ telefɔni nataw fɛ.


Aerospace ani Lafasali Elektroniki

Aerospace ni lafasali siratigɛ la, yɔrɔ minnu na dannaya ni baarakɛcogo de ka bon kosɛbɛ cogoya juguw la, PTFE fini min dilannen don ni fibreglasi ye, o ye baara caman sɔrɔ. K’a ta rada sitɛmuw ni sateliti cikanw na ka se ɛntɛrinɛti kɛlɛminɛnw ma, nin fɛn in ka kuran baarakɛcogo, funteni sabatili, ani sigida gɛlɛnw kɛlɛli faralen ɲɔgɔn kan, o b’a kɛ sugandili ɲuman ye. A girinya dɔgɔyali n’i y’a suma ni laadala PTFE fɛnɲɛnamafagalanw ye minnu falen bɛ seramiki la, o fana bɛ kɛ sababu ye ka sɛnɛfɛnw musaka dɔgɔya fiɲɛ kɔnɔ.


Nizɛri ni RF/Micro-onde Circuits teliyaba

Nizɛri sɛrɛkiliw ka waati teliya min bɛ ka caya ani ka gɛlɛya ka taa RF ni mikro-onde baarakɛcogo la min ka bon kosɛbɛ, o kɛra sababu ye ka PTFE fini don min dilannen don ni fibreglasi ye, o kɛra fɛn ye min bɛ taa dilanbagaw fɛ. A ka dielektriki sabatili dɔgɔyali bɛ sira Di taamaʃyɛnw jɛnsɛnni teliya ma, k’a sɔrɔ a ka bɔnɛ dɔgɔyali cogoya bɛ se ka kɛ sababu ye ka antɛniw ni filɛriw dilan minnu bɛ baara kɛ ka ɲɛ, minnu ka surun. Nizɛri teliyaba baarakɛcogo la, o fɛn in ka kuran cogoya basigilenw bɛ se ka kɛ sababu ye ka taamasiyɛnw dafalen sabati, ka dɔ bɔ bitiki filiw la ani ka sistɛmu bɛɛ ka baarakɛcogo ɲɛ.


Fɛn dilanni jateminɛw ani siniko taabolo


Fɛɛrɛ minnu bɛ kɛ ka fɛnw dilan ka ɲɛ

Baara kɛli ni PTFE fini ye min dilannen don ni fibreglasi ye, o bɛ fɛn dilanni fɛɛrɛ kɛrɛnkɛrɛnnenw de wajibiya walasa k’a ka jogo kɛrɛnkɛrɛnnenw nafa bɛrɛbɛrɛ. Laser drilling ni plasma etching kɛcogo kɔrɔw labɛnna walasa ka vias (vias) ni fine-line circuitry (sira finmanw) dilan k’a sɔrɔ u ma fɛn in kuran cogoya tiɲɛ. O fɛn dilanni fɛɛrɛ tigitigiw bɛ kɛ sababu ye ka PCB gɛlɛnw dilan, minnu bɛ se ka kɛ fɛn caman ye, minnu bɛ dancɛw gɛlɛya baarakɛcogo la min bɛ kɛ ni fɛn caman ye.


Fɛnɲɛnɛmafagalan minnu musaka ka dɔgɔ ani fɛnkurabɔli minnu bɛ kɛ ni fɛnw ye

Hali ni PTFE fini min dilannen don ni fibreglasi ye , o bɛ baara kɛcogo ɲuman di, a musaka kɛra dan ye laada la baara dɔw la. Nka, ɲininiw ni yiriwali cɛsiri minnu bɛ senna, olu sinsinnen bɛ furakɛlicogo dɔw dilanni kan minnu musaka ka dɔgɔ, minnu bɛ kuran ni funteni nafa nafamaw mara, ka sɔrɔ ka fɛnw musaka bɛɛ lajɛlen dɔgɔya. O ko kura ninnu ye fɛnɲɛnɛmafagalanw ye minnu bɛ PTFE ni polimɛri wɛrɛw fara ɲɔgɔn kan minnu tɛ bɔnɛ dɔgɔya, ka fara finidoncogo kɔrɔw kan minnu bɛ PTFE layini janya n’a kɛcogo ɲuman kɛ.


Lamini jateminɛw ani a sabatili

Ikomi ɛntɛrinɛti baarakɛlaw bɛ ka u sinsin kosɛbɛ sabatili kan, fini minnu dilannen don ni PTFE ye, olu dilannikɛlaw bɛ ka fɛɛrɛ wɛrɛw ɲini minnu tɛ sigida lakana ani ka fɛnw lasegin u cogo kɔrɔ la. Hali ni PTFE yɛrɛ tɛ se ka kɛ kemikɛli la, wa a tɛ baga ye, cɛsiriw bɛ senna walasa ka fɛn dilanni fɛɛrɛw labɛn minnu bɛ sabati ani ka fɛnw lasegin u cogo kɔrɔ la. Dilanbaga dɔw bɛ ka sɛgɛsɛgɛli kɛ biyo-based alternatives kan ka tɛmɛn laadala PTFE ɲɛfɛfɛnw kan, k’a laɲini ka dɔ bɔ PCB fɛnw na minnu bɛ baara kɛ kosɛbɛ, k’a sɔrɔ u ma u ka kuran nafa danfaralenw tiɲɛ.
